Output ef8085154e9f8c4411697eb11bf4095a19f86ec45e9e80c0b67839222cfe9a3d:0

value
14415090033
script pubkey
OP_0 OP_PUSHBYTES_20 2bb5d00284f69dad1fb719cef861e19ae20a12f1
address
ltc1q9w6aqq5y76w668ahr880sc0pnt3q5yh3gsef7y
transaction
ef8085154e9f8c4411697eb11bf4095a19f86ec45e9e80c0b67839222cfe9a3d
spent
true